
An analytics pipeline that tracks and analyzes GitHub contributions with AI-powered summaries and contributor scoring.
Eliza Leaderboard is an open-source analytics pipeline developed by Andreessen Horowitz (a16z) designed to track, analyze, and summarize GitHub contributions. It processes data such as pull requests, issues, reviews, and comments to calculate contributor scores based on activity and impact. The system also generates AI-powered summaries of contributions, providing insights into developer expertise and focus areas. It supports exporting daily summaries and maintaining interactive contributor profiles with visualized activity metrics.
Intended for analytics and infrastructure developers, Eliza Leaderboard requires integration with GitHub via a personal access token and optionally uses the OpenRouter API for AI-generated summaries. The pipeline is built with TypeScript and runs on Bun or Node.js environments. It features modular commands for data ingestion, processing, exporting, and summarizing, enabling flexible customization and automation through GitHub Actions workflows.
What sets Eliza Leaderboard apart is its combination of detailed GitHub activity tracking with AI-powered summarization and a smart scoring system that quantifies contributor impact. Its architecture separates code and data branches to optimize Git history management and supports database serialization for efficient version control. The project also includes tools for database exploration and CI/CD deployment to GitHub Pages, facilitating easy setup and continuous updates.
Developers can deploy their own instance by configuring environment variables, repository tracking, and GitHub Actions workflows. The pipeline supports syncing production data or initializing an empty database, with detailed migration and troubleshooting guides. Use cases include monitoring open-source project contributions, generating developer activity reports, and building community leaderboards. Comprehensive documentation and example configurations are available on GitHub to help teams get started quickly.
Open-source projects and organizations often struggle to quantify and analyze developer contributions effectively. Manual tracking of GitHub activity is time-consuming and lacks actionable insights. Additionally, summarizing contributor impact and expertise across multiple repositories is challenging without automated tools.
Tracks pull requests, issues, reviews, and comments across configured GitHub repositories.
Calculates scores based on activity volume and impact to rank contributors.
Provides web pages with contributor profiles and activity metrics.
Exports summaries and reports in JSON format for further analysis or display.
Track and analyze developer contributions across multiple repositories to identify key contributors and activity trends.
Generate AI-powered summaries and scoring reports to showcase individual or team contributions for performance reviews or community recognition.
Build interactive leaderboards and profile pages to motivate contributors and foster community engagement.
